What is deep tissue massage?
Deep tissue massage focuses on relieving pain and improving circulation in areas with chronic tension. This is especially helpful for tight shoulders, tense lower backs and stiff necks. Many people experience some discomfort during the massage as deeper pressure is necessary to address this kind of tension. After your massage, you may enjoy relief from tension-related pain and greater range of motion.
What is hot stone massage?
Hot stone massage is deeply relaxing to the mind and body. Your therapist will place water-warmed stones on your body. The heat softens tense areas while your therapist massages areas not being treated by the stones. Later, the stones will be removed and the warmed areas massaged.

What will I wear during my treatments?
Reiki, Jin Shin Jyutsu, Reflexology and Shiatsu are performed over clothing. Most other massage and body treatments are enjoyed without clothing. Undergarments may be worn if preferred. Please wear what is most comfortable for you. All of our therapists are trained to drape sheets discreetly throughout treatments. Your privacy and modesty are respected at all times.
